The global market for EV High-voltage Isolated Switches was estimated to be worth US$ 4394 million in 2025 and is projected to reach US$ 26940 million, growing at a CAGR of 30.0% from 2026 to 2032.

The EV High-voltage Isolated Switches market is segmented as below:
By Company
Panasonic
Xiamen Hongfa Electroacoustic
Denso
TE Connectivity
Omron
BYD
Shanghai SCII
Song Chuan Precision
Sanyou Relays
Shenzhen Busbar
YM Tech
Sensata Technologies
Segment by Type
Main Relay
Quick Charge Relay
Others
Segment by Application
BEV
PHEV
